Computer Accounts

As a Linfield Student, you are eligible for a Linfield College computing account, which along with your proxy password will give you complete access to the Libraries' databases to search for books, articles and other materials. You will need your Linfield student ID number which is on the front of your photo ID. To obtain your computer name and password fill out the application for an computer account. Delivery of Library Material

We will send you items that are not found at local libraries, but are owned by Linfield. For example, books and journal articles from journal's in Linfield's catalog will be mailed to you at no extra cost to you. You will need only to pay postage to return books. The articles are copies that you may keep.

Orbis Cascade Alliance Borrowing

You can borrow books not owned by local community libraries or Linfield from a consortium of academic libraries called Orbis. The Orbis Cascade Alliance catolog is the combined catalogs of all institutions in the consortium. You can order books from the Orbis Cascade Alliance catalog to be mailed to your home or for pick-up at another library. Learn How

Interlibrary Loan

Linfield Library will request for you the following items via interlibrary loan:

  1. Books not owned by Linfield Libraries or local libraries
  2. Books not in the Orbis catalog
  3. Journal articles in journals not owned by Linfield's Northup Library in McMinnville, and not available on online full text databases such as EBSCOhost. Check Periodicals@Linfield to see.
